Good moral judgments should be logical and question 5 options:

Social Studies
1 answer:
ololo11 [35]3 years ago
7 0

<span>The correct answer is c. based on facts and acceptable moral principles. </span>

Good moral judgements should be logical and premised on moral reasoning. This means that they should follow on what is defined as wrong or right by ethical principles such as Virtue Ethics and deontology.

Why were the aztecs defated so easily
Zolol [24]

Answer:

The Aztecs no longer trusted Montezuma, they were short on food, and the smallpox epidemic was under way. More than 3 million Aztecs died from smallpox, and with such a severely weakened population, it was easy for the Spanish to take Tenochtitlán.Sep 29, 2017
